BJTM Wins at ARA 2023, Reinforces Commitment to GCG Implementation

JAKARTA, September 7, 2024. PT Bank Pembangunan Daerah Jawa Timur Tbk (bankjatim) has successfully won a prestigious award at the 2023 Annual Report Award (ARA). Following its first-place victory in the BUMD Financial category at ARA 2022, the largest regional development bank in East Java was once again named the winner in the same category at the ARA 2023 Awarding Night held at the Indonesia Stock Exchange Building in Jakarta on Monday evening (10/8). Carrying the theme "Internalizing Integrated Mindset Toward Sustainable Long Term Value Creation," the award was received by Independent Commissioner of bankjatim Sumaryono and President Director Busrul Iman.
Busrul expressed his gratitude and appreciation for the award granted to the company, stating that the recognition highlights bankjatim’s successful implementation of Good Corporate Governance (GCG). According to him, strengthening GCG practices is not just an obligation but a necessity for public companies. Therefore, bankjatim’s management is committed to upholding GCG principles—transparency, accountability, responsibility, independence, and fairness—as the foundation for the company’s operations.
Busrul added that by applying sound governance, the company can ensure smooth operations, build stakeholder trust, and comply with regulatory standards. “We thank the ARA 2023 organizers for evaluating and appreciating our GCG practices. This award will serve as motivation for all Jatimers to strengthen our commitment to GCG implementation going forward, with the goal of making bankjatim the number one regional development bank (BPD) in Indonesia,” he said.
Bankjatim’s consistent GCG application is reflected in its continuously growing financial performance. As of the first half of 2024, the bank has disbursed loans totaling IDR 58.07 trillion, growing 18 percent year-on-year (YoY). This growth demonstrates the company's ability to maintain expansion despite interest rate hikes and liquidity challenges. Additionally, bankjatim’s Loan to Deposit Ratio (LDR) stood at 71.6 percent, indicating a healthy liquidity position.
This ARA 2023 achievement adds to the long list of accolades bankjatim has received for its annual reporting. In 2023, bankjatim earned a gold rank in The Asia Sustainability Reporting Rating (ASRRAT) hosted by the National Center for Corporate Reporting (NCCR). In the same year, the bank also received an A rating for its 2021 Sustainability Report from the Foundation for International Human Rights Reporting Standards (FIHRRST). “With this ARA recognition, we hope to further support bankjatim’s performance and improve the quality of governance and information for our stakeholders,” said Busrul.
The 2023 ARA was participated in by 167 companies, of which only 27 were selected as award winners, including bankjatim. Professor Mardiasmo, Chairman of the National Committee on Governance Policy and Head of the ARA 2023 Steering Committee, explained that ARA aims to promote corporate governance principles in Indonesian companies through transparency and governance practices—including sustainability—by evaluating annual and sustainability reports and providing feedback to all ARA participants.
